This is an AIO mount for the BC-250, it' specifically designed for the following:

  • MSI MAG Coreliquid A15

  • Thermalright Aqua Elite (My recommend AIO and make sure its the ARGB or ARGB V2 only)

  • Minorsonic

Support for other coolers will be on you to try, it has support for LGA 1851 and AM4/5 bolt patterns, so it can support additional brands, there is also a generic one you can try.

This needs to be printed in a strong stiff material, mine is printed from PC-CF, Id suggest minimum material would be ABS, or ABS-CF, please do not print from PLA or PETG, except for checking fitment.

  • Added a back plate, this should be used for all mounts, and will increase clamping pressure on the APU and will also slightly increase contact pressure with the VRAM modules, and will limit the PCB from flexing when clamping the pump block down.

Please Note: The threaded inserts are not designed to be thermally set, they are press fit from the bottom, the recommend ones are are perfect fit, have a 6mm x 1mm lip to prevent them from being pulled through the plastic, all you need to do, is hold them on place with your finger, and from the other side, wind in the M3 bolt, and tighten it down, this will pull the threaded insert into place, I use a small M3 washer on the bolt to prevent the bolt from damaging the plastic, if you use normal threaded inserts, they can pull right through if tightened to much, these ones I use, do not, I use them in all my designs now, and I design so they do not require melting into place, my method is better, stronger and easier, but you have to purchase the correct ones.

  • If you are considering this and are wondering if you will need to go to a 360 rad, I can confirm you wont, the 240 will be enough, 360 is overkill, I have pushed my test board to the limits, pulled well over 400w of power from the wall, have maxed out the clocks and voltages, ran countless benchmarks and game tests, the MSI 240 barely gets warm, and it does it in silence, if you needed more, then upgraded the 1500rpm stock fans with some good Arctic or Noctua would be all you would need.

BOM For the Thermalright and Minorsonic:

Note: You print the thumb nuts and spring seats for these coolers, minimum mounting bolt length is 45mm, longer is fine, shorter will make mounting difficult and can compress the springs to much, also please make sure to check you are purchasing the correct Thermalright AIO, as there is about 50 models called the same thing, will want one of these types: ARGB or ARGB V2
